People Assisting The Homeless (PATH) - VISTA
 
 
 
People Assisting The Homeless (PATH) was founded on the Westside of Los Angeles by a group of concerned community members looking to support their neighbors on the streets. What started as community members providing food and clothing to those living in the streets, has grown into one of largest homeless service providers in California. In Los Angeles we provide a variety of services for our neighbors experiencing homelessness that include employment, outreach, homelessness prevention, housing navigation, interim housing, rapid rehousing, and permanent supportive housing. We are moving thousands of families, Veterans, and chronically homeless individuals into permanent housing each year.

Member Duties : PATH serves homeless families, homeless Veterans, and chronically homeless adults. As the VISTA member, you will assist to coordinate volunteer and donation programs which directly support these clients while they are enrolled in PATH’s homeless services, and after they are permanently housed. Other major functions will include reviewing current volunteer and donation partnerships; conducting research to identify new potential volunteer partnerships; and supporting volunteer recruitment and retention strategies for specific PATH programs. This is a meaningful year of service that provides VISTAs an opportunity to alleviate poverty within the Los Angeles homeless communities.
